i eat samurai arums
peach fuzz anoints gentle harmonium.
amino humour cracks
humus with blood gilt spittle

aurora aorta sorta
pumps
like a shaduf welled
with mall rivers marvel

rivetted skin slaps slaughtered high eyes
peeling back the frame
while skeletal names
remain

letters envelope

stamps heel their anklets
on necklace trains
steaming each puff in tunnel
version visions

scallop one hoisted oyster
in the cloistered foyer
and goya is mink
and manure
uncle toms sawyer
